City Jaipur is the state capital Rajasthan, and is known as Pink City. This feature is because it was built entirely in pink stucco, and now that color is a symbol of hospitality for its inhabitants.

Undoubtedly, Jaipur is an extremely picturesque in India. It does not end there. The Elephant Festival is one of the main events in the city, and that is to say that during this time, any visitor is impressed by the huge players in the celebration. The joy and deployment are present in Jaipur, hand this ancient tradition teaches us to connect with the roots of its people.

It is during the day before Holi -La Festival of Colors- Which develops the annual festival of the Elephant. Huge hand-embroidered fabricsWith all the skill and art of Hindu women cover and decorate the magnificent specimens Asians who move to calm passage through the streets of the city.

Typical metal bracelets give them away to go, tinkling merrily with the movement of heavy gray bodies, yet prove to be capable of great skill. And although this is his party, the elephants do not walk alone at Jaipur during the celebrations.

Also camels and horses elegantly parade during the procession, giving the event more colorful character, capable of surprising everyone present. Indeed it is a great opportunity to enjoy a Traditional event and come into contact with the culture of the locals.

But the celebrations do not end with the procession. The more adventurous can venture on the back of an elephant, and go and the streets of Jaipur from the heights of a vehicle that moves faster and shaky than it appeared from the ground.

And if it was mentioned to his skill, this takes place entirely during the struggle that develops in the Polo Golf City, the Jaipur Chaughan. The huge animals face with surprising agility and emitting their loud sounds typical, that deafening crowds.
